About automotiveMastermind:

Who we are:

Founded in 2012, automotiveMastermind is a leading provider of predictive analytics and marketing automation solutions for the automotive industry and believes that technology can transform data, revealing key customer insights to accurately predict automotive sales. Through its proprietary automated sales and marketing platform, Mastermind, the company empowers dealers to close more deals by predicting future buyers and consistently marketing to them. automotiveMastermind is headquartered in New York City.
